Carbohydrate-Binding Module Family 36

Activities in FamilyModules of approx. 120-130 residues displaying structural similarities to CBM6 modules. The only CBM36 currently characterised, that from Paenbacillus polymyxa xylanase 43A, shows calcium-dependent binding of xylans and xylooligosaccharides. X-ray crystallography shows that there is a direct interaction between calcium and ligand.
3D Structure Statusβ-sandwich
NoteFormerly known as X9 modules
